Abstract

The invention provides a low-load rescue stretcher, and relates to the technical field of stretchers, the low-load rescue stretcher comprises a lying plate, the two sides of the bottom of the lying plate are respectively and fixedly connected with a group of three-section type telescopic rods, and the middle end of each group of three-section type telescopic rods is fixedly connected with a leg supporting seat. According to the stretcher device, a patient is placed on the lying plate, the lower body and the upper body of the patient are fixed to the stretcher device through the first bandage and the second bandage respectively, the feet of the patient cannot step on the bottom supporting frame, the weight of the patient is dispersed, unnecessary weight is reduced, meanwhile, the fixing plate is rotated to keep 20 degrees relative to the lying plate, blood clot backflow can be prevented, and the stretcher device is convenient to use. The stretcher can be folded through the three-section type telescopic rods, so that the occupied space is reduced, the stretcher is convenient to carry by the rescue workers, and the stretcher can be driven to move quickly by pulling the pull rods.
